Spatial distribution and occurrence probability of regional new particle formation events in eastern China

Abstract: Abstract. In this work, the spatial extent of new particle formation (NPF) events and the relative probability of observing particles originating from different spatial origins around three rural sites in eastern China were investigated using the NanoMap method, using particle number size distribution (PNSD) data and air mass back trajectories. The length of the datasets used were 7, 1.5, and 3 years at rural sites Shangdianzi (SDZ) in the North China Plain (NCP), Mt. Tai (TS) in central eastern China, and Lin… Show more

“…This process can occur both locally or on a larger scale; in the latter case the events are characterized as regional. Regional events have been found to take place on a scale of hundreds of kilometres (Németh and Salma, 2014;Shen et al, 2018), without being affected by air mass advection (Salma et al, 2016). NPF is one of the main contributors of particles in the atmosphere (Spracklen et al, 2010;Kulmala et al, 2016;Rahman et al, 2017) and this relative contribution increases when moving from a kerbside to a rural area (Ma and Birmili, 2015).…”

“…The effect of other meteorological variables is even more complex, with studies presenting mixed results on the effect of the wind speed and atmospheric pressure. Extreme values of those variables may be favourable for the occurrence of NPF events, as they are associated with increased mixing in the atmosphere, but at the same time suppress due to increased dilution of precursors Rimnácová et al, 2011;Shen et al, 2018;Siakavaras et al, 2016), or favour them due to a reduced condensation sink (CS).…”
